近年来微波已被应用于包括口腔粘膜病和口腔肿瘤在内的多种疾病,但用于防止癌前病变恶化的研究尚少。本实验采用微波辐射金地鼠颊囊白斑,比较模型组和微波组远期癌变率,观察肉眼和光镜下的组织细胞变化规律,摸索最佳技术参数,旨在为临床推广应用提供动物实验参考依据。结果发现微波辐射能有效地降低白斑癌变率;其光镜和肉眼观察到的变化规律有助于揭示微波阻癌的可能机理;明确了正常掌握技术参数,严格控制最佳升温值是提高疗效的关键。
